Basilica of Notre-Dame de la Garde

1. Basilica of Notre-Dame de la Garde

4.7 (48,778)
観光名所教会礼拝所Association Or Organization観光名所

A breathtaking panorama awaits you. Experience a vibrant sanctuary atop a hill overlooking the Mediterranean.

クイックファクト: This basilica has been watching over Marseille from the top of the La Garde hill, offering a 360-degree panoramic view of the city and the Mediterranean Sea. Each year, more than a million visitors come to admire its architecture and its golden statue of the Virgin and Child, a protective symbol for sailors.

見どころ: The gilded copper statue of the Virgin, nearly 11 meters tall, catches the sunlight to sparkle like a beacon. The interior walls are decorated with colorful mosaics and marine votives, evidence of the many prayers answered for sailors and local inhabitants.

Old Port of Marseille

2. Old Port of Marseille

4.6 (6,982)
自然の特徴施設

A sensory journey between maritime history and salty flavors. Discover the lively fish market and sunlit bustling docks.

クイックファクト: The port welcomes more than 25,000 visitors a day, transformed into a fish market every morning with over 30 different species displayed. Since antiquity, this place has served as a strategic trading point between the Mediterranean and the city.

見どころ: On Sunday mornings, a tradition draws locals and tourists alike: the fish market where fishermen sell their fresh catch directly on the quays. A unique view emerges as dozens of colorful boats line up, with the Mucem in the background on the horizon.

Calanques National Park

3. Calanques National Park

4.7 (21,061)
国立公園Wildlife Refuge観光名所公園観光名所

A spectacular landscape between sea and mountain draws nature lovers. Discover hidden coves and colorful marine life in store.

クイックファクト: More than 20,000 hectares of calanques stretch between Marseille and Cassis, combining white cliffs with turquoise waters. Rare biodiversity can be observed, such as the ocellated lizard and the red gorgonian deep in the sea.

見どころ: The calanques offer a striking contrast between white limestone rock, fragrant pine trees, and secret coves where the sea shines emerald green. A local legend says that fishermen share century-old stories here while enjoying seafood caught that day.

Palais Longchamp

4. Palais Longchamp

4.6 (19,514)
公園観光名所歴史的ランドマーク歴史的な場所博物館

An architectural masterpiece you must see. Explore its fountains, sculptures, and green spaces for a cultural and relaxing escape.

クイックファクト: The palace houses an immense fountain 30 meters high that celebrates the arrival of drinking water in Marseille. More than 2,700 sculptures decorate its façades, a spectacle for lovers of art and architecture.

見どころ: A gigantic cascade jets forth beneath the central dome, surrounded by rare animal sculptures such as lions carved from Castries stone. The outdoor music scene in the park attracts young local talents every weekend in summer.

MuCEM - Museum of European and Mediterranean Civilisations

5. MuCEM - Museum of European and Mediterranean Civilisations

Museum of European and Mediterranean Civilisations

4.4 (23,791)
博物館観光名所観光名所施設

Explore 8000 years of fascinating Mediterranean and European history. Enjoy an immersive visit with unique architecture and rich, varied collections.

クイックファクト: The main building rests on an ancient 17th-century military fort, offering a view of the Mediterranean Sea. The museum gathers more than 450,000 objects illustrating European and Mediterranean civilizations.

見どころ: The openwork metal lattice bridge connecting the different sections of the museum creates shadow plays throughout the day, changing the indoor atmosphere. The museum exhibits culinary, religious, and artistic traditions with videos, ancient objects, and interactive technologies.

Château d'If

6. Château d'If

4.6 (5,457)
Castle観光名所歴史的な場所観光名所施設

Explore a legendary fortress-prison on an island at sea. Discover the austere cells and admire the spectacular view over Marseille.

クイックファクト: A fortified prison on a rocky island, famous thanks to Alexandre Dumas’ novel "The Count of Monte Cristo." More than 40 meters tall, it served as a prison for hundreds of inmates often sent without trial.

見どころ: The view from the ramparts offers an impressive panorama of the Mediterranean and the Old Port. Walking through the dark cells and hearing the echoes of prisoner stories transports you into a timeless atmosphere.

La Canebière

7. La Canebière

3.9 (380)
Route

A boulevard revealing the maritime soul of the city. Stroll through history, cafes, and lively shops of the Old Port.

クイックファクト: La Canebière extends about 1.2 kilometers from the Old Port to the Church of the Reformés. The name comes from "canebière," a hemp plant once cultivated here for rope making.

見どころ: The colorful façades of 19th-century buildings tell the maritime trading history of the city. In the shade of these buildings, passersby can still smell the salty air mixed with roasted coffee from the many cafés.

伝統的な甘い料理

Calisson

Calisson

Calisson is a traditional Marseille sweet made from a smooth mixture of ground almonds, candied melon, and orange peel, topped with a thin layer of royal icing.

Navettes de Marseille

Navettes de Marseille

Navettes are boat-shaped biscuits flavored with orange blossom water, symbolizing the boats used during the traditional pilgrimage to Notre-Dame de la Garde.

Pompe à l'huile

Pompe à l'huile

Pompe à l'huile is a sweet olive oil bread typically enjoyed during Christmas and signifies the Provençal way of celebrating with a rich, aromatic taste.

伝統的な塩味料理

Bouillabaisse

Bouillabaisse

Bouillabaisse is a famous fish stew originating from Marseille, made with various Mediterranean fishes, shellfish, and a unique blend of herbs and spices.

Pieds et paquets

Pieds et paquets

This dish consists of sheep's feet and offal parcels cooked slowly in white wine and herbs, reflecting Marseille's resourceful use of ingredients.

Panisse

Panisse

Panisse is a chickpea flour cake, fried or baked to golden perfection, representing Marseille's Ligurian culinary influence.

伝統的な飲み物

Pastis

Pastis

Pastis is a popular anise-flavored spirit typically diluted with water, enjoyed as a refreshing aperitif in Marseille.

Vin de Cassis

Vin de Cassis

Vin de Cassis is a sweet blackcurrant liqueur from nearby Cassis, often mixed with white wine to make the refreshing Kir cocktail.

Cioudèt

Cioudèt

Cioudèt is a traditional Marseille barley water beverage, perfect for cooling down during warm Provençal summers.

Frequently Asked Questions about Marseille, France

Is Marseille, France safe for travelers?
Marseille has a mixed reputation regarding safety, but most tourist areas are safe if you stay vigilant. Like in any big city, avoid showing valuables and take standard precautions, especially at night. Crime rates vary depending on the neighborhoods.
How many days are needed to visit Marseille, France?
3 to 4 days are ideal to explore Marseille. This allows you to visit main attractions like the Old Port, Notre-Dame de la Garde, and enjoy the beaches and local markets without rushing.
What is the best time to visit Marseille, France?
The best time to visit Marseille is sp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October). The weather is pleasant with temperatures around 20-25°C, fewer crowds than in summer, and prices are generally more affordable.
Is Marseille, France an expensive city for tourists?
Marseille is moderately priced. A meal at a restaurant costs on average between 15 and 30 euros. Accommodation ranges from 50 to 150 euros per night depending on comfort. Public transport costs about 1.70 euros per ticket, which is reasonable.
How to get around in Marseille, France?
Marseille has a good public transport network, including metro, tram, and bus. A ticket costs about 1.70 euros. Biking and walking are also popular in the city center. For excursions, renting a car is useful.
